As glass processing techniques become more varied, a wide range of materials can now be combined with glass. Low temperature ultra clear EVA interlayer is designed to meet the requirements of composite materials that are sensitive to high temperatures when paired with glass, such as acrylic (PMMA), silk fabric, heat-sensitive color-changing materials, wicker, and sensitive paper, INNOLA EVA Film has developed a low temperature (minimum 70℃) EVA film.

  • Product Overview: Innola Low-Temp Ultra-Clear EVA Film is a premium-grade interlayer formulated with imported raw materials and advanced performance additives. Specially engineered for artistic and decorative laminating, it achieves excellent melt flow, superior cross-linking, and pristine optical clarity at a low temperature of just 70°C. It is the ultimate choice for encapsulating heat-sensitive inserts (such as fine silk, textiles, organic polymers, and decorative metals) without risk of damage. It also supports standard high-temperature cross-linking (125°C) to meet heavy-duty outdoor structural specifications.

Main Characteristics

  • 70°C Low-Temperature Protection for Delicate Inserts: Achieves flawless adhesion and maximum optical clarity at low processing temperatures. It is engineered specifically to eliminate burning, shrinkage, or discoloration when laminating heat-sensitive elements like premium silk, linen, artisan paper, organic plants, or acrylic (PMMA).

  • High Flow Ability — The Enemy of Wire Mesh Bubbles: Features an optimized Melt Flow Index (MFI: 12-16). The flowing resin perfectly encapsulates intricate wire meshes, metallic fabrics, and thick textiles, expelling air completely to eliminate micro-bubbles or void-induced delamination.

  • Ultra-Clarity: Complies with strict Ultra-Transparency optical standards. The cured film offers a high-definition, haze-free profile that elevates the visual presentation of decorative inserts and artistic wire installations.

  • Dual-Temperature Processing Versatility: Flexible dual-mode processing. At 125°C, it reaches a high cross-linking density of 85%–90% with maximum structural strength, ideal for high-performance outdoor architectural laminated glass.

  • Universal Multi-Substrate Bonding: Universally bonds inorganic substrates (float glass, low-iron glass, marble, ceramics, metals) with organic polymers (PMMA/Acrylic, PC, PET, PVC) and delicate decorative inserts seamlessly.

  • Elite UV Filtering & Weather Resistance: Blocks over 99% of harmful UV rays (under 380nm). It protects interior decorative inserts against fading and yellowing, maximizing the lifespan of artistic installations.

Recommended Applications & Processing Modes

 

Processing Flexibility

This multi-purpose film is suitable for low-temperature decorative laminating (e.g., wire mesh, fabric, acrylic combinations) as well as high-temperature processing for heavy-duty outdoor structural laminated glass.

  • Processing Mode A (Low-Temp Processing @ 70°C): Yields excellent bonding capability and optimal optical clarity without overheating the core materials.

  • Processing Mode B (High-Temp Processing @ 125°C): Yields peak adhesion energy, maximum optical transmission, and a cross-linking density of 85%–90% for high-durability projects.

 

Substrate Compatibility Guide

  • Inorganic Materials: Float glass, tempered glass, low-iron glass, marble slabs, ceramic tile surfaces, metals, and their respective printed graphics.

  • Organic Polymers: PMMA (Acrylic), Polycarbonate (PC), PET, PVC sheets, and their printed decorative overlays.

  • Interlayer Inserts: Premium silk, decorative wire mesh, fabrics, polymer, woven cotton/linen, specialty artisan washi paper, and custom prints PET films.

⚠️ Important Technical Note: When installing finished laminated glass, always verify the chemical compatibility of perimeter sealants (such as structural silicone or weatherproofing sealants) with the EVA interlayer. Certain incompatible chemical sealants or aggressive chemical detergents can migrate into the edge, causing delamination, edge bubbling, or localized blackening.

 

Storage, Handling & Transportation

  • Environmental Control: Store in a clean, climate-controlled warehouse where the temperature remains below 25°C (77°F) and relative humidity (RH) is strictly below 50%.

  • Physical Protection: Avoid direct sunlight, prevent water or moisture ingress, keep away from localized heat sources (radiators/machinery), and do not place heavy, concentrated loads on the rolls to prevent pressure-creasing.

  • Partially Used Rolls: Reseal remaining film meticulously in its original moisture-barrier packaging. Before using an opened roll for a new production run, it is highly recommended to process a small test sample (minimum 0.5 m²) to verify that no moisture absorption has compromised the film quality.

  • Usage Window: Once the original protective vacuum packaging is opened, take protective dust-proof and moisture-proof measures. It is recommended to consume the roll fully within 3 months.
